Bridge over Para Creek on Martin Luther Kingweg temporarily closed to traffic

The concrete bridge on Martin Luther Kingweg, over Para Creek, will be temporarily closed to all traffic. The closure is due to scheduled maintenance work on the bridge.

The closure will take effect on Monday, June 22, 2026, at 9:00 AM and will last until Sunday, June 28, 2026, at 6:00 PM. During this period, road users will not be able to use the bridge.

A detour has been established for traffic via Dwarkaweg, Sir Winston Churchillweg, and Mahadjan Adhinweg. Heavy transport must use the Bouterse Highway during the closure period.

According to the commissariat, Meursweg is strictly prohibited for heavy transport. This was announced on behalf of the District Commissioner of Para, Mr. Patrick Kensenhuis.

District Commissioner Ernesto R. Muller of Wanica South-East urgently appeals to all road users to strictly follow the instructions of the police and the posted traffic signs. According to the commissariat, this is necessary for the safety of all road users and for the smooth execution of the work.
